Output 66e229d93e225dffd75bebf3a4aee4d7558797149c023574a3422d589e7e4988:12

value
1930846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c898982623bcddf4c972014d02277b09398426f OP_EQUAL
address
38fi3NVFjA1sQbPqYQGQMzfkXYSXYNRv4j
transaction
66e229d93e225dffd75bebf3a4aee4d7558797149c023574a3422d589e7e4988